Luxembourg - Nuts Stock Variation
Since 2014, Luxembourg Nuts Stock Variation grew 10.7% year on year. With -3 Thousand Metric Tons in 2018, the country was ranked number 90 among other countries in Nuts Stock Variation. Iran lead the ranking with 219 Thousand Metric Tons in 2018, a growth of 65.9% compared to 2017. Turkey, Tanzania and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. India witnessed the best average annual growth at +78.7% per year, while Myanmar wit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
